What is an AI customer service agent?
An AI customer service agent reads incoming support requests, prioritises them, and drafts a reply for a human agent to approve and send. Unlike a generic website chatbot, the Sandlabs agent grounds every answer in your own help content and keeps a person in the loop — so customers get accurate, on-policy responses, faster.
How is this different from a customer service chatbot?
A chatbot talks to customers directly and often guesses. Our AI agents for customer service work behind the scenes in your inbox: they draft answers from your real documentation, and a human reviews before anything is sent. That removes the biggest risk of support AI — a confidently wrong reply reaching a customer.
